Structural foundation repair services focus on diagnosing and addressing issues related to the stability and integrity of a building’s foundation. These services typically involve assessing the extent of foundation problems, which can include cracks, uneven settling, or shifting. Once the issues are identified, contractors may employ various techniques such as underpinning, piering, or slabjacking to stabilize and reinforce the foundation. The goal is to restore the foundation’s strength, prevent further damage, and ensure the safety and longevity of the property.
These repair services help resolve common foundation problems that can lead to significant structural concerns if left unaddressed. Cracks in walls or floors, doors and windows that stick or do not close properly, and uneven or sloping floors are often signs of foundation issues. Over time, these problems can worsen, leading to more extensive damage to the property’s framing, drywall, and other structural elements. Foundation repair aims to correct these issues before they escalate, reducing the risk of costly repairs and maintaining the property’s overall stability.

Foundation Repair Costs - The cost for foundation repair services typically ranges from $2,000 to $7,000, depending on the extent of damage. Minor repairs may be closer to the lower end, while extensive foundation work can approach or exceed the higher range.
Factors Influencing Expenses - Costs vary based on the type of repair needed, such as crack injections or underpinning. For example, crack repairs might cost around $1,500, whereas complete underpinning could be $10,000 or more.
Material and Method Variations - The choice of materials and repair methods impacts costs significantly. Helical piers or steel supports generally fall within a moderate price range, while more invasive procedures tend to be more costly.
Location and Accessibility - The local market and site accessibility influence pricing, with repairs in areas like Greendale, WI, typically falling within standard regional ranges. Difficult access or complex soil conditions may increase overall expenses.

What are common signs of foundation issues? Indicators may include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, doors or windows that stick or do not close properly, and gaps around window frames or door jambs.
How long does foundation repair usually take? The duration of repair work varies depending on the extent of the damage, but most projects can be completed within a few days to a week.
Are foundation repairs disruptive to my home? Repair methods are typically designed to minimize disruption, but some noise, dust, or temporary access restrictions may occur during the process.
What causes foundation problems in homes? Common causes include soil movement, poor drainage, plumbing leaks, or inadequate foundation design, which can lead to settling or shifting over time.
